The Planters Inn in Savannah has a problem with theft. On a recent stay (10/2/2012), I used their valet parking service. My car was broken into, ransacked, and personal items were stolen, including a lap-top computer, GPS, and cell phone. The car showed no signs of forced entry and the alarm never went off, and so I conclude that it was either deliberately or carelessly left unlocked. This was apparently not a rare occurence; the hotel manager told me that I would probably find my discarded suitcase abandoned somewhere near my car in the garage (which he did), and the police told me that they have a problem with this type of crime. The hotel refunded my room charge but took no responsibility for the theft, even though it was their employee who parked my car and had the key. Because of such negligence, I would discourage anyone from staying at the Planters Inn.
